Once we did a search into authorities (from items or from Authorities module),
the last selected authority has no visual mark to identify it in the
authorities list.
It will be usefull if when we are editing an authority, this authority appears
in a different color (from others ones) until an another one was selected.
The authorities list can be long and there is no indication where the last
édited one was when we return on the authorities list.
(Similar as bug #7501 for OPAC in 2012 ?)
